About This Book
"The Treaty of Amsterdam committed European Union Member States to tackle social exclusion: a commitment taken forward by the Lisbon meeting of EU political leaders in 2000. The aim of this book is to explore from an inter-disciplinary perspective the possibilities and limitations of the attempts by the EU to co-ordinate and 'Europeanize' Member States' strategies and policies to tackle poverty and social exclusion"--
